The natives gather along the beaches, awaiting a special event that occurs each cycle during the end of the rainy season. As though by magic, the waves begin climbing the shores higher and higher. A great thundering roar echoes across the shores. The great king of the sea surfaces, moving its enormous body through the water at incredible speeds, causing the tides to reach ever higher, washing up many pounds of sea life both small and large onto the beaches. The natives cheer, for their god has given them a bountiful banquet that will sustain them for many suns to come.

However, not all is well. The god of the seas begins thrashing about, getting aggravated, the natives unaware of what has caused their deity such distress. Storm clouds move in, and the whole area becomes drenched in rain as thunder booms louder than any storm before it, and lightning strikes as though it were dancing upon the Earth below. The natives scatter, scrambling back to their shelters.

The great sea king rises from his element, standing high above the land, looking up towards the sky with a determined look. As though he were challenging the storm, the god of the oceans lets loose a tremendous roar that shakes the very ground from which he stands. As he does, a dark shape moves through the clouds, and lets loose a shriek that deafens the ears of many, as though accepting the duel that the god of the oceans has offered.
